Job Title: RF Test Technician
Job Description
The RF Test Technician performs functional testing, troubleshooting, and tuning of RF electronic assemblies to ensure they meet defined specifications and quality standards. This role follows established operational procedures, uses a wide range of electronic test equipment, and supports production schedules in a collaborative manufacturing environment.
Responsibilities
- Follow operational procedures, including routing and work instructions, and maintain accurate production records for electrical assemblies.
- Perform functional testing of RF electronic assemblies according to part-specific, pre-established test procedures.
- Test and troubleshoot RF electronic assemblies down to the board and component level to identify and resolve issues.
- Perform troubleshooting and tuning using test set hardware, fixtures, and software to optimize performance.
- Monitor tests from start to completion, record test data accurately, and service test equipment as required.
- Interpret and follow blueprints, guidelines, and diagrams to ensure products meet specifications and tolerance levels.
- Perform proper loading and unloading of electronic equipment in test beds to support safe and efficient testing.
- Demonstrate correct use of electronic and manual test equipment in daily operations.

Essential Skills
- Minimum 3–5 years of RF and electronics experience related to production testing.
- At least 3 years of experience working as an RF Test Technician.
- Proficiency in RF testing and troubleshooting down to board and component level.
- Hands-on experience using test tools such as Spectrum Analyzer, Vector Network Analyzer (VNA), RF Signal Generator, Oscilloscope, Power Meter, Power Sensor, Vector Signal Analyzer (VSA), and Vector Signal Generator (VSG).
- Ability to follow and interpret blueprints, guidelines, and diagrams to verify product specifications and tolerances.
- Demonstrated ability to use simple hand tools, machine tools, and mechanical measuring devices correctly.
- Strong computer skills, including proficiency with Microsoft Office applications.
- Knowledge and background in the use of a wide variety of electronic measurement, stimulus, and communication instrumentation used to test aerospace products.
